Syllabus
1. What a business actually asks
30 hoursTurning a vague question into one data can answer.
-
The question behind the question
"Sales are down" is not an analysis brief. Getting to "which branch, which product, since when, compared with what" before touching a spreadsheet.
-
Metrics that mean something
Choosing a measure a decision can act on, and spotting the vanity number that only ever goes up.
-
Where the data lives
hands on
Point-of-sale exports, an ERP, a Google Sheet, a WhatsApp group. Real Pakistani businesses, realistically.
-
How analysis misleads honestly
Survivorship, selection, and the average that hides two different populations.
2. Excel and Google Sheets, properly
50 hoursThe tool most of your clients will actually have.
-
Cleaning data that arrived badly
hands on
Inconsistent phone formats, merged cells, dates as text, trailing spaces. Where most of the job's hours really go.
-
Lookups, pivots and dynamic ranges
hands on
XLOOKUP, pivot tables, and building something that does not break when a row is added.
-
Power Query for repeatable cleaning
hands on
Doing the cleaning once so next month is a refresh, not a repeat.
-
A workbook someone else can use
hands on
Documented, protected, and not dependent on you being in the room.
3. SQL
50 hoursGetting the data yourself instead of asking for an export.
-
SELECT, WHERE, ORDER BY, LIMIT
hands on
Reading data with intent.
-
JOINs, and what happens when they go wrong
hands on
Inner versus left, and the duplicate-row explosion that quietly doubles a revenue figure.
-
GROUP BY and aggregation
hands on
Counts, sums, averages, and HAVING versus WHERE.
-
Window functions
hands on
Running totals, rankings and month-on-month change — where SQL stops being a data-fetching tool and becomes an analysis one.
4. Visualisation and dashboards
50 hoursPower BI and Looker Studio, and the judgement behind them.
-
Choosing the right chart
hands on
Why a pie chart with nine slices communicates nothing, and what to use instead.
-
Building in Power BI
hands on
Data model, relationships, measures and a dashboard that loads quickly.
-
Looker Studio for clients with no licence
hands on
The free route, and where it runs out.
-
Designing for the person who will look at it once a week
The single number at the top, and what belongs behind a click.
5. Statistics you will actually use
30 hoursEnough to avoid being confidently wrong.
-
Distributions, and why the average is often the wrong summary
Median, spread and the long tail — with real salary and sales data.
-
Correlation is not causation, demonstrated
Working through a real pair of correlated series that have nothing to do with each other.
-
Is this difference real?
hands on
Sample size, variation and the practical version of significance — enough to know when a 3% lift is noise.
-
Forecasting simply, and its limits
Trend and seasonality, and saying plainly how uncertain a forecast is.
6. Telling the story
30 hoursThe part that decides whether any of it gets used.
-
Structuring a findings report
hands on
Answer first, evidence second, method last — the opposite of how the work was done.
-
Presenting to people who do not like numbers
hands on
Rehearsing the one sentence a manager will repeat to their boss.
-
Saying "the data does not show that"
Holding a finding under pressure, and how to disagree with a client without losing them.
-
Documenting so the analysis can be repeated
Sources, assumptions and steps — the difference between an analysis and a one-off spreadsheet.
